PROBLEM TO BE SOLVED: To provide a pressure pulsation analyzing device taking the influence of damping on the whole piping system into account. SOLUTION: In this pressure pulsation analyzing device 100, a fluctuation velocity distribution form calculating part 104 calculates a distribution form of fluctuation velocity in the piping system without taking damping of pressure pulsation into account by using the inputted set conditions. A total loss energy calculating part 106 calculates total loss energy of pulsation lost in the whole piping system, based on the fluctuation velocity distribution form. A governing equation holding part 112 holds a governing equation of fluid in an excitation source in the form taking damping of pressure pulsation into account. An equivalent damping coefficient calculating part 108 calculates an equivalent coefficient of damping of the excitation source by setting the total loss energy as loss energy lost in the excitation source. An excitation source pulsation response analyzing part 110 analyzes pulsation response in the excitation source by substituting the equivalent coefficient of damping for the governing equation. A piping system pulsation response analyzing part 114 analyzes pulsation response in the whole piping system, based on the pulsation response in the excitation source and the fluctuation velocity distribution form.
